Abstract
The title of this study is "Language features through gender differences in some Instagram advertisements" limited to gender language. This study analyzed the different language features in men's and women's language that are found on Instagram advertisement captions. This study aims to analyze the different characteristics of men's and women's language features and find the function behind them. This study used the theory of Baxter (2010), Lakoff (2004), and Leech (1947) to analyze the several language features that are found on Instagram advertisement captions. A qualitative method was used to analyze the data, and presented on informal form with descriptive analysis techniques. From the data analysis it was found that there are different language characteristic in men and women such as the use of harsh and slang language which is more common in men’s language than in women and the different vocabularies that chosen in men and women language, about rapport or report, an opinion, or intensifiers. Moreover, from the language feature are founded had several functions as informative, expressive, directive, aesthetic, and phatic. This shows that male and female language features are found in the distribution of advertisements on Instagram which are not widely known by Instagram users themselves.
